Well, D-day is tomorrow! I am supposed to be packing and cleaning the house; there is a mountain of miscellaneous items that have to be packed spread all over the house. A little voice inside my head (a.k.a you Gwen) is telling me "do as much as you can as early as you can", but I can' t believe how quickly this trip has snuck up on us. It was about a year ago that Peter and I decided to go and months and months of counting down has turned into one miniscule (but much needed) sleep. Excitement is brimming, as Peter has booked us into a hostel very near to Buckingham Palace and I have checked what in-flight movies we will have on offer - can't wait to watch "Slumdog Millionairre".
